1. Size
The dimension of a chronometer is a crucial determinant of its suitability and aesthetic appeal, particularly in the context of a delicate, argent-toned lady’s timepiece. The overall proportions influence wearability and visibility, impacting the user’s experience and perceived value.
-
Case Diameter
Case diameter dictates the visual prominence of the watch on the wrist. Smaller diameters, typically ranging from 24mm to 30mm in this category, provide a subtle and understated look. A diameter exceeding this range may diminish the desired delicacy and femininity associated with a specifically sized lady’s watch.
-
Case Thickness
The case’s profile contributes to the overall wearability. Thinner cases, often below 8mm, enhance comfort and allow the watch to slide easily under sleeves. A thicker case, while potentially housing more complex movements, can detract from the intended sleekness and elegance.
-
Band Width
The width of the band should be proportional to the case diameter to maintain visual harmony. A band that is too wide can overpower the watch face, while a band that is too narrow can appear flimsy. A balanced ratio is essential for a cohesive and refined aesthetic.
-
Lug-to-Lug Distance
Lug-to-lug distance, the measurement from one lug (where the band attaches) to the other, affects how the watch sits on the wrist. A shorter lug-to-lug distance is generally preferable for smaller wrists, preventing the watch from appearing too large or ill-fitting.

2. Material
The selection of materials is paramount in the design and construction of a diminutive, argent-toned lady’s time-telling instrument. Material choice dictates not only the aesthetic appearance but also durability, weight, and hypoallergenic properties, impacting the wearer’s comfort and the timepiece’s longevity.
-
Silver Alloys
While pure silver is rarely used due to its softness and susceptibility to tarnishing, silver alloys are common. Sterling silver (92.5% silver and 7.5% other metals, typically copper) provides a good balance of luster and durability. However, sterling silver still requires regular polishing to maintain its shine. Other alloys, such as those incorporating palladium or platinum, offer increased tarnish resistance, albeit at a higher cost.
-
Stainless Steel with Silver Finish
Stainless steel is a frequently employed base metal due to its inherent strength, corrosion resistance, and hypoallergenic properties. A silver-toned finish, achieved through plating or other coating techniques, replicates the appearance of solid silver at a more accessible price point. The durability of the finish is contingent on the plating process and the wearer’s habits; scratches can reveal the underlying steel. Some brands use PVD (Physical Vapor Deposition) coatings which are known for improved durability and longevity.
-
Titanium with Silver Finish
Titanium offers a lightweight and hypoallergenic alternative. While darker in its natural state, titanium can be coated with a silver-toned finish. Titanium is significantly more scratch-resistant than stainless steel but also more expensive. Its lower density contributes to a more comfortable wearing experience, particularly for those sensitive to heavier watches.
-
Band Materials
The material of the band is as crucial as that of the case. Options include metal bracelets (constructed from silver alloys, silver-finished stainless steel, or titanium), leather straps (offering a classic and comfortable alternative), and synthetic materials (providing water resistance and durability). The band material should complement the case’s material and overall design aesthetic.

3. Movement
The movement is the internal mechanism that powers a timepiece, dictating its accuracy, reliability, and overall value. In the context of a diminutive, argent-toned lady’s time-telling instrument, the choice of movement significantly influences the watch’s dimensions, aesthetic design, and maintenance requirements. The suitability of a particular movement hinges on its balance of size, precision, and cost-effectiveness.
-
Quartz Movements
Quartz movements utilize a battery to power a quartz crystal oscillator, providing exceptional accuracy and requiring minimal maintenance. Their compact size allows for slim case designs, a desirable feature in women’s watches. However, quartz movements lack the craftsmanship and mechanical artistry associated with mechanical alternatives. Battery replacements are necessary, typically every one to two years.
-
Mechanical Movements (Manual-Winding)
Manual-winding mechanical movements require the wearer to wind the crown regularly to maintain power. These movements showcase traditional watchmaking techniques and offer a connection to the history of horology. They tend to be thicker than quartz movements, potentially impacting the case profile. Accuracy can vary, and periodic servicing is essential to ensure optimal performance.
-
Mechanical Movements (Automatic/Self-Winding)
Automatic movements utilize the motion of the wearer’s wrist to wind the mainspring, providing continuous power without manual winding. Like manual-winding movements, they represent mechanical artistry and craftsmanship. Automatic movements are generally bulkier than both quartz and manual-winding movements. A rotor, responsible for self-winding, contributes to the increased thickness. Accuracy can vary, and regular servicing is required.
-
Movement Size and Design Constraints
The overall dimensions of a specific time-telling device are often directly dictated by the physical size of the movement housed within. Certain argent-toned lady’s chronometers necessitate smaller movements, which, in turn, limits the mechanical features and sophistication that can be incorporated. Designers must meticulously balance functionality with aesthetics to create a cohesive and visually appealing timepiece.

5. Durability
In the context of a small, silver-toned timepiece designed for women, durability transcends mere longevity; it encompasses resistance to daily wear, maintenance of aesthetic appeal, and sustained functional performance. The ability to withstand the rigors of daily life is a critical factor in the overall value and satisfaction derived from such an accessory.
-
Material Hardness and Scratch Resistance
The selection of materials directly impacts the susceptibility of the case and bracelet to scratches and dents. As previously outlined, While solid silver alloys offer a classic aesthetic, stainless steel and titanium with silver finishes provide enhanced durability and affordability. The choice affects its resistance to common abrasions encountered during daily activities, from casual contacts to impacts against hard surfaces. High hardness values, measured on scales like Vickers or Rockwell, indicate greater resistance to surface damage. Plating the material used is also essential for the material used of the piece.
-
Water Resistance and Environmental Factors
Exposure to moisture and environmental pollutants can degrade the appearance and functionality of a time-telling device. Even minimal water resistance (e.g., 30 meters) provides protection against splashes and brief immersion. However, more robust water resistance (e.g., 50 meters or higher) is desirable for individuals engaged in water-related activities. Furthermore, resistance to humidity and corrosive substances, such as sweat and certain cosmetics, extends the lifespan of the watch components.
-
Movement Protection and Shock Resistance
The internal movement, whether quartz or mechanical, requires protection from physical shocks and vibrations. Shock resistance is often quantified using standardized tests (e.g., ISO 1413) that simulate impacts and assess the movement’s ability to maintain accuracy. Effective shock absorption mechanisms within the case minimize the transfer of energy to the delicate components of the time-telling device, thereby safeguarding against damage and ensuring continued operation.
-
Clasp Integrity and Band Security
The clasp and band attachment points are subject to considerable stress during normal use. A robust clasp mechanism, constructed from durable materials and designed for secure closure, prevents accidental detachment and loss of the watch. Similarly, reinforced band attachment points ensure the band remains securely connected to the case, even under tension or impact. The selection of a high-quality clasp and band attachment system contributes significantly to the overall durability and reliability of the time-telling device.

6. Clasp
The clasp serves as the critical fastening mechanism connecting the two ends of a watch bracelet or strap, securing the timepiece to the wearer’s wrist. For a small, silver-toned lady’s chronometer, the clasp’s design and functionality are paramount, influencing both the security of the timepiece and its aesthetic integration with the overall design. The clasp’s failure can result in the loss of the watch, underscoring its significance as a key component. A poorly designed clasp can also detract from the watch’s appearance, creating an imbalance in the overall aesthetic harmony. For instance, a bulky or unattractive clasp on a delicate silver band can disrupt the visual flow and diminish the perceived value of the watch.
Several clasp types are commonly employed, each offering varying degrees of security, adjustability, and aesthetic appeal. Deployment clasps, often featuring push-button releases, provide a secure closure and prevent the bracelet from fully detaching, minimizing the risk of accidental dropping. Ladder clasps, typically found on adjustable bracelets, offer incremental sizing adjustments for a precise fit. Jewelry clasps, such as lobster claw or spring ring clasps, are often favored for their streamlined appearance but may offer less security than deployment clasps. The choice of clasp depends on the specific design requirements of the watch, balancing security, comfort, and aesthetic integration. As an example, a minimalist watch with a clean dial might feature a hidden deployment clasp to maintain a sleek, uninterrupted bracelet design.

Frequently Asked Questions
The following questions address common inquiries and concerns regarding the selection, maintenance, and suitability of this particular type of timepiece.
Question 1: Is a solid silver case preferable to a stainless steel case with a silver finish?
A solid silver case offers a distinct aesthetic, but is more prone to scratching and tarnishing. Stainless steel with a silver finish provides greater durability and resistance to corrosion, often at a more accessible price point. The optimal choice depends on individual priorities regarding aesthetics versus long-term maintenance.
Question 2: What level of water resistance is appropriate for a ladies argent-toned watch intended for everyday use?
A water resistance rating of at least 30 meters is recommended to protect against accidental splashes and brief immersion. For individuals regularly exposed to water, a rating of 50 meters or higher is advisable.
Question 3: How often should a quartz-powered argent-toned ladies timepiece have its battery replaced?
Battery replacement frequency varies depending on the movement and usage patterns. Typically, a battery will require replacement every one to two years. Reduced accuracy or a sudden cessation of operation indicates the need for a new battery.
Question 4: Are mechanical movements more accurate than quartz movements in these instruments?
Quartz movements are generally more accurate than mechanical movements. Mechanical movements are susceptible to variations in temperature, position, and winding state, which can affect their accuracy. However, some wearers value the craftsmanship and aesthetic appeal of mechanical movements over absolute precision.
Question 5: What are the most effective methods for cleaning and maintaining a diminutive, argent-toned lady’s time-telling instrument?
Regular cleaning with a soft, dry cloth is recommended to remove dirt and smudges. For more thorough cleaning, a mild soap solution can be used, ensuring the watch is adequately water-resistant. Silver components may require occasional polishing with a silver-specific cleaning agent to remove tarnish.
Question 6: Is a warranty essential when purchasing this type of horological device?
A warranty is highly recommended as it provides protection against manufacturing defects and malfunctions. The warranty period and coverage vary depending on the manufacturer and retailer. Reviewing the terms and conditions of the warranty prior to purchase is advisable.

Essential Selection Considerations
The following recommendations provide a framework for discerning consumers seeking to acquire a diminutive, argent-toned lady’s time-telling instrument. Careful consideration of these points can optimize the purchase and ensure long-term satisfaction.
Tip 1: Prioritize Fit and Comfort
The dimensions of the time-telling device should align with the wearer’s wrist size. A case diameter exceeding 30mm may appear disproportionate on smaller wrists. Assess the band’s adjustability and ensure it conforms comfortably to the wrist without causing irritation.
Tip 2: Evaluate Legibility under Varying Conditions
The dial should offer clear visibility in diverse lighting environments. Consider models with luminous hands or markers for enhanced readability in low-light conditions. Assess the contrast between the dial color and the hands to ensure effortless time reading.
Tip 3: Scrutinize the Movement Type
Quartz movements offer superior accuracy and require minimal maintenance, while mechanical movements showcase horological artistry and craftsmanship. Select the movement type that best aligns with individual preferences and priorities. Factor in the increased maintenance requirements of mechanical movements.
Tip 4: Assess Water Resistance Rating
Even if the intended use is primarily for dress occasions, a water resistance rating of at least 30 meters is advisable to protect against accidental splashes. For those frequently exposed to water, a rating of 50 meters or higher is recommended.
Tip 5: Verify Material Quality and Finishing
Examine the case, bracelet, and clasp for imperfections in the finishing. Ensure that the materials used are of high quality and resistant to corrosion or tarnishing. Pay attention to the quality of the silver plating, if applicable, to ensure its durability and longevity.
Tip 6: Inspect the Clasp Security
The clasp should provide a secure and reliable closure to prevent accidental detachment of the time-telling device. Consider clasp types that offer both security and ease of use, such as deployment clasps with push-button releases.
Tip 7: Confirm the presence of a Valid Warranty.
A current warranty is essential to cover the repairs should it break down for manufacturing reasons and for reassurance.
